  • Let's talk about this role
  • This 12 month contract as Policy Administration Specialist you will be responsible for providing outstanding customer service through ensuring the health of nib's customer policies. This is done through effective, efficient and accurate processing of policyholder information.
  • You will initially provide administrative support to the team by effectively managing the workflow and key priorities of the business in an accurate and timely manner meeting KPI's.
  • This role will see you transition into providing more technical support for complex policy and legislation enquiries and activities.
  • More specifically you will:
  • Communicate, both written and verbal, with a variety of internal and external stakeholders, including customers and other Health Insurers)-
  • Ensure policy administration admin items are accurately fulfilled and any tasks that are required by the business are actioned-
  • Accurately and efficiently process customer policy information exceptions, manual customer policy information, and other related functions including Transfer Certificate Requests, Failed joins online, broker joins and amendments and Failed correspondence fulfilment.-
  • Accurately calculate Lifetime Health (LHC) refunds for members and provide detailed responses to members-
  • Accurately and efficiently action complex member policy information exceptions. Including remediating compliance issues that affect member's policies
